Eaton Golf Club - Cheshire
Bounded to the west by the Shropshire Union Canal, the course at Eaton Golf Club is an early 1990s design from Donald Steel, with holes routed through woodland and around a couple of streams that run through the property.
The layout extends to 6714 yards from the back markers, playing to a par of 72, with holes arranged as returning loops, the front nine laid out around the periphery of the property, enclosing the back nine in the middle.
Notable holes on the outward half include the slightly right doglegging par four 3rd (rated stroke index 1); the par five 5th (with a pond protecting the front left of the green); and the 437-yard 9th, where out of bounds runs the length of the fairway on the left.
On the inward half, highlights include the par four 12th (where a stream cuts diagonally across the front of the green); the par four 15th (with this green also guarded at the front by water); and the shortest of the par threes at the 152-yard 17th, played to a two-tiered green.
